Gatorade G2 Origins
Gatorade G2 is a lower-calorie version of the original Gatorade drink. It was made for people who want to stay hydrated without extra sugar.
This drink started as a way to give athletes a lighter option. It keeps the taste of Gatorade but with fewer calories.
Launch And Purpose
Gatorade G2 was first launched to meet the needs of athletes and active people. It aimed to provide hydration with less sugar and fewer calories.
The purpose was to offer a drink that helps with energy and hydration without the extra carbs. It targets those who want a lighter sports drink.
Target Audience
The main audience for Gatorade G2 includes athletes, fitness fans, and people watching their calorie intake. It suits those who want hydration but less sugar.
Many people who want a healthier sports drink choose G2. It fits well for those who need energy but want to avoid high calories.

Alternatives To Gatorade G2
Gatorade G2 can be hard to find in some stores or regions. People look for other drinks to stay hydrated and energized.
This guide shows other drinks you can try instead of Gatorade G2. These options include other Gatorade products and drinks from other brands.
Other Gatorade Options
If you cannot find Gatorade G2, try other drinks from the Gatorade line. They offer similar hydration and electrolytes.
Some options have more sugars, while others have fewer calories but still help with hydration.
- Gatorade Thirst Quencher: The classic, with full electrolytes and sugar.
- Gatorade Zero: No sugar and zero calories, good for low-calorie needs.
- Gatorade Endurance: Made for athletes, with extra electrolytes.
- Gatorade Organic: Uses organic ingredients, with natural flavors.
Competing Brands
Other brands make drinks like Gatorade G2. They offer hydration and electrolytes for active people.
These drinks often come in many flavors and low-calorie choices. They are good alternatives if Gatorade G2 is not available.
- Powerade Zero: A sugar-free sports drink with electrolytes.
- BodyArmor Lyte: Low-calorie and rich in electrolytes and vitamins.
- Propel Electrolyte Water: Flavored water with electrolytes but no sugar.
- Vitaminwater Zero: Zero sugar with added vitamins for hydration.

What Makes Gatorade G2 Different From Regular Gatorade?
Gatorade G2 contains fewer calories and less sugar than regular Gatorade. It targets consumers seeking hydration with lower calorie intake.
